About Zhou Cui
Zhou Cui is a scholar working on Materials Chemistry, Electronic, Optical and Magnetic Materials, Catalysis, Metals and Alloys and Toxicology, having authored 49 papers that have together received 509 indexed citations. Recurring topics across this work include 2D Materials and Applications (25 papers), MXene and MAX Phase Materials (19 papers), Heusler alloys: electronic and magnetic properties (8 papers), Graphene research and applications (7 papers), Perovskite Materials and Applications (6 papers), Electromagnetic wave absorption materials (3 papers), Chalcogenide Semiconductor Thin Films (3 papers) and Topological Materials and Phenomena (3 papers). The work is most often cited by research in Materials Chemistry (361 citations), Electronic, Optical and Magnetic Materials (139 citations), Renewable Energy, Sustainability and the Environment (96 citations), Electrical and Electronic Engineering (150 citations) and Catalysis (13 citations). Zhou Cui has collaborated with scholars based in China, Australia and New Zealand. Frequent co-authors include Baisheng Sa, Cuilian Wen, Rui Xiong, Yinggan Zhang, Yu Feng, Hao Liu, Zhimei Sun, Bo Wu, Tomoki Ogoshi and Jian Zhou. Their work appears in journals such as Journal of Materials Chemistry C, Chemical Engineering Journal, Physical Chemistry Chemical Physics, Applied Surface Science and Materials.
